草庐IT

mpeg2video

全部标签

video - 在没有 Flash 的情况下在 HTML5 中嵌入 YouTube 视频

是否可以使用HTML5在您自己的网站上嵌入YouTube视频,这样它就可以在没有Flash的情况下在iPhone上的Safari上播放? 最佳答案 根据http://apiblog.youtube.com/2010/07/new-way-to-embed-youtube-videos.html:这将在HTML5视频中播放(当HTML5视频不可用时回退到Flash)。 关于video-在没有Flash的情况下在HTML5中嵌入YouTube视频,我们在StackOverflow上找到一个类

caching - 什么情况下浏览器会缓存<video>文件?

浏览器在什么情况下会缓存文件?有时会,有时不会。如果这里没有人知道,我的下一步将是测试各种文件格式、文件大小和htaccess场景。如果您不知道,您能想到您推荐测试的任何其他变量吗?提前致谢! 最佳答案 以下工作是指示浏览器缓存文件。最后一行是使服务器传送具有正确headerMIME类型的webm文件所必需的。#Expiresissettoapointwewon'treach,#Cachecontrolwilltriggerfirst,10daysafteraccess#10Days=60sx60mx24hrsx10days=864

javascript - 有没有办法在 HTML5 中播放 mpeg 视频?

我基于pc的网络应用程序使用HTML5,我想导入mpeg文件以在我的浏览器中播放,这些文件已被其他应用程序以这种方式保存。有没有办法用HTML5播放这些视频文件?编辑:应用程序尝试从本地硬盘而不是服务器播放mpeg文件。因此,用户可以选择mpeg文件来播放选定的mpeg文件。HTML:Javascript:(functionlocalFileVideoPlayerInit(win){varURL=win.URL||win.webkitURL;varsources=[];varj=1;varvideoNode=document.querySelector('video');varvide

video - 我可以预加载多个视频资源以在同一个 HTML5 <video> 元素中加载吗?

我正在制定一个Web应用程序的详细信息,该应用程序涉及顺序加载一长串(非常短的)视频剪辑,一个接一个,用户偶尔会输入建立新的视频剪辑加载方向.我希望能够让浏览器一次预加载五个视频剪辑。然而,我们目前网站的运作方式是通过单个视频元素,该元素的src属性通过JavaScript不断更新。有没有一种直接的方法可以让浏览器预加载多个视频剪辑,即使我最终将它们全部(一次一个)加载到同一个视频元素中? 最佳答案 您可以通过创建在浏览器中预加载图像JavaScript中的标记,并设置其src属性。尽管任何规范都没有要求,但所有浏览器都会下载图像并

Android HTML5 视频 - 单击播放时有效,但不是 video.play()

我了解Android上的html5视频无法自动播放。就目前而言,只有当用户点击播放按钮时,我的视频才能在设备上运行。$(function(){varvideo=document.getElementById('video');video.play();});不过它可以在我的桌面上运行。为什么这行不通?点击播放和使用.play()有什么区别? 最佳答案 由于浏览器阻止调用window.open()的相同原因,它不会起作用,因为允许它允许Web开发人员颠覆用户不自动播放媒体(或打开弹出窗口)的偏好).点击播放和使用此方法之间的区别正是您

html - 在 HTML5 Video 中,如何从一个长视频中播放一个小片段?

我想展示一个超过10分钟的长视频文件中的一个小片段。这段视频将从90秒的时间偏移/寻道时间开始,持续时间为45秒。我怎样才能做到这一点? 最佳答案 HTML5视频还支持MediaFragmentURI规范这将允许您仅指定要播放的视频片段。使用它相当简单:将在30秒标记开始播放视频并在45秒标记暂停视频。 关于html-在HTML5Video中,如何从一个长视频中播放一个小片段?,我们在StackOverflow上找到一个类似的问题: https://stack

video - HTML5 视频缩放模式?

我正在尝试制作全屏HTML背景,这很简单。但是因为HTML5视频在保持宽高比的同时调整了大小以适合容器,所以我无法获得想要的效果。HTML5视频是否有不同的缩放模式?我想缩放以填充和裁剪。这是在Flash中完成的预期效果:http://www.caviarcontent.com/如果您调整窗口大小,您会看到它会缩放和裁剪。你永远不会得到黑条。感谢您的帮助! 最佳答案 使用CSS实现此目的的另一种方法是使用object-fit属性。这适用于视频或img元素video{object-fit:cover;}http://caniuse.c

javascript - 在页面的 ajax 加载部分初始化 Video.js 播放器

视频播放器实际上加载正常。我的实际问题是当我使用AJAX刷新页面的某些部分并且这些部分包含视频播放器时,HTML5播放器加载正常,但不是Video.js自定义它的部分。video.js文件加载在页面的头部。我已阅读文档,但找不到如何在已加载的页面上初始化视频播放器。当加载我的包含视频的页面部分以使视频播放器正确加载Video.js时,是否没有可以调用的myPlayer.initialize()函数?我认为video.js文件仅在页面加载时自动执行此操作。感谢您宝贵的帮助! 最佳答案 我遇到了同样的问题。我的场景:通过ajax加载带有

video - 更改正在 HTML5 视频中播放的视频

我正在使用HTML5中的标签在网络浏览器上播放视频...(我对这个新功能印象深刻)是否有通过Javascript更改正在播放的视频的功能?假设当我从列表中选择另一个视频时,将调用一个Javascript函数,该函数将包含MyVideo.VideoLocation=//locationofnewvideotobeplayed行中的内容。请问这样可以吗?感谢和问候,Krt_马耳他 最佳答案 Webkit要求您在更改源后调用“load()”:videoTag.src="newVideo";videoTag.load();videoTag.

Chrome 中的 HTML5 <video> 标签不起作用

我注意到HTML5有一个奇怪的问题Chrome中的标记。使用这个,它工作正常:这只播放声音,不播放视频:如果我删除poster属性,它再次起作用。所有其他浏览器(甚至IE9...!)都运行良好,但我似乎找不到原因。任何想法/帮助?谢谢 最佳答案 视频标签的属性应该被指定以严格执行标准:如果这不起作用,则您的浏览器偏好设置有所更改 关于Chrome中的HTML5标签不起作用,我们在StackOverflow上找到一个类似的问题: https://stackove